The five senses
I sit down on my yoga cushion. At this exercise with my mala, I think of at least five things for each of my senses. I go through my chain bead by bead and consider:
- Eyes: What do I like to see. When beam my eyes? What colors, patterns, flowers. Sunset, landscapes, nature, paintings and so on.
- Ears: What do I like to hear. What music, what tones or sounds. Waterfall, birds chirping, crickets chirping and so on.
- Nose: What do I like to smell. Which scents, aromas, flowers and so on.
- Tongue: What do I like to taste. What is my favorite dish, which drinks, which flavour aroma and so on.
- Fingers: What do I like to feel. What feels well under my fingers, what do I like to touch. Animal fur, velvet, grass, cool earth, hot sand, and so on.
But also: What do I like to feel on my own skin? To be petted. Water under the shower on my skin, silk fabric and so on.
